Account Doesn't Reconcile for March 25
I design for ERP implementations, and know a few things about "Going Live."
It's been over 3 weeks since the conversion and several things have happened and are happening.
United properly converted my miles.
It fixed the double deduction of upgrades.
So as of March 3, my data is correct.
Three items remain as issue AFTER the sytem conversion:
1) The United Mileaage calculator tool you see in the navigation breadcrumbs
Home > MileagePlus > Earn Miles > United Airlines
This calculator does not take into account the 500 mile minimum that Premiers and above get on flights.
2) My last UX flight booked in Full Fare Y did not calculate the proper Class of Service bonus according to the published table.
3) My Premier Qualifying Miles from my flights NRT to IAD in Z and IAD to YOW in Y do not reflect in the PQM balance.
Whenever I talk to United, I have a detailed reconciliation available.

RPU's are still glitchy and not always processing correctly. Had SFO-IAD for next sat and was waitlisted w/ 2 RPU's pre-merger. Checked inventory this morning and it was showing R8 but the RPU's were still waitlisted & not clearing. Ended up calling and having them manually clear me.
I think the bottom line is you have to baby sit this process. But on the positive side, I got through to an agent within 5 minutes.
